Don't forget there's something such as amrams- missiles designed to hit radars and jammers. Purpose designed loitering drones they do the same thing soon. Use EW, get an explosive kamikaze drone on your head.
Also, drones are layered.
Ground UGVs-
1. Ground drones with claymores
2. Ground drones with antitank mines
3.missile and machine gun armed ground drones
4. Recon and radio repeater drones
5. Engineer drones for mine clearance
6. Supply drones carrying food, ammo, water, and other goodies to troops
7. Patrol drones for anti drone defense
8. Antiarcraft drones networked together that are on sentry duty and periodically change locations
UAVs-
1. Micro copters at squad level for recon
2. Platoon level quad copters for overwatch and targeting
3. FPV drones with AT/AP warheads to knock out bunkers, armored vehicles, and HVTs
4. Loitering drones for long range targets
5. Drone defense copters with ramming ability for hitting small drones plus explosives if helicopters are in the area
6. Anti fighter drones with rocket assisted terminal attack phase for hitting low flying aircraft
7. Radar and jammer seeking drones
8. Long range stealth loitering munitions for theater based operations
I'm GWOT, we were constantly aware of the IED threat. The saying was that the design and implementation of IEDs were only limited by the imagination.
This is next level IEDs, except now, they come at you at 100 mph

I wouldn't call the Kord a "watered down 50 Cal".
What can it do better than an m240?
How about shoot a 650 grain bullet at 2900 fps with over 4 times the energy and over 3 times the penetration of armor and hard barriers, all at twice the range.
We already use the M2. It's time to make it more shootable. On unstable gunnery, it's very difficult to hit targets at even moderate distances unless locked in with a T&E with the M2. Giving the gun a proper buttstock and optics mount will allow gunners a better chance of hitting while free gunning.
I don't understand the resistance to modernizing the heavy machinegun. We modernized the 1917 machinegun, to the 1919, and eventually adopted proper GPMGs. The 50 can be modernized to the same degree, allowing a more accurate, lighter, and easier to shoot HMG.
It's a no brainier and something the US military has been promising for decades to the infantry.
